pub enum KeyDerivationAlgorithm {
Pbkdf2,
Hkdf,
}Variants§
Trait Implementations§
Source§impl Clone for KeyDerivationAlgorithm
impl Clone for KeyDerivationAlgorithm
Source§fn clone(&self) -> KeyDerivationAlgorithm
fn clone(&self) -> KeyDerivationAlgorithm
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for KeyDerivationAlgorithm
impl Debug for KeyDerivationAlgorithm
Source§impl From<KeyDerivationAlgorithm> for KeyDerivationAlgorithm
impl From<KeyDerivationAlgorithm> for KeyDerivationAlgorithm
Source§fn from(value: KeyDerivationAlgorithm) -> KeyDerivationAlgorithm
fn from(value: KeyDerivationAlgorithm) -> KeyDerivationAlgorithm
Converts to this type from the input type.
Source§impl PartialEq for KeyDerivationAlgorithm
impl PartialEq for KeyDerivationAlgorithm
impl Copy for KeyDerivationAlgorithm
impl Eq for KeyDerivationAlgorithm
impl StructuralPartialEq for KeyDerivationAlgorithm
Auto Trait Implementations§
impl Freeze for KeyDerivationAlgorithm
impl RefUnwindSafe for KeyDerivationAlgorithm
impl Send for KeyDerivationAlgorithm
impl Sync for KeyDerivationAlgorithm
impl Unpin for KeyDerivationAlgorithm
impl UnsafeUnpin for KeyDerivationAlgorithm
impl UnwindSafe for KeyDerivationAlgorithm
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more